Mark Gross <mgross@unix-os.sc.intel.com> writes:
>
> Any driver that holds a lock across any sleep_on call I think is abusing
> locks and needs adjusting.
That's true for spinlocks, but not for semaphores. The mm layer and the
vfs layer both use semaphores extensively and sleep with them hold,
also some other subsystems (like networking) use sleeping locks.
